Background
The LED street lamp is a street lamp manufactured by using an LED light source, has the unique advantages of high efficiency, safety, energy conservation, environmental protection, long service life, high response speed, high color rendering index and the like, and has very important significance for urban illumination and energy conservation. The radiating effect of the existing LED street lamp shade is poor, so that heat of the LED lamp can be accumulated inside the lamp shade after the LED lamp works for a period of time, and the LED lamp works in a high-temperature environment, so that the service life of the LED lamp is greatly reduced.

The working principle of the LED street lamp shade with high heat dissipation performance is as follows:
during the installation, install lamp panel and LED lamp in the casing, then will descend the lamp shade to install in the casing bottom, when LED lamp work produced the heat, the heat transmits to the lamp shade in through the heat dissipation fin, then carries out quick conversion through the subassembly of taking a breath with the inside heat of lamp shade again, thereby dispel the heat to last lamp shade fast, make the inside temperature reduction of lamp shade and then can continue to accomplish the heat transfer through the heat dissipation fin, thereby make the inside heat reduction of casing, improve LED's life.
Furthermore, the air exchange assembly comprises an air exchange shell, a refrigerator, a connecting pipe and an air pump are arranged in the inner cavity of the air exchange shell, the refrigerator is communicated with the air pump through the connecting pipe, the air inlet pipe is communicated with the air pump, and the air outlet pipe is communicated with the refrigerator.
From the above description, it can be known that the hot air in the upper lamp cover can be pumped into the refrigerator through the air pump, and is discharged into the upper lamp cover again after being refrigerated by the refrigerator, so that the heat exchange is completed, and the heat exchange is rapidly performed in the upper lamp cover.
Furthermore, the inner cavity of the shell is further provided with a threaded column, two opposite side surfaces of the lamp panel are respectively provided with a first nut and a second nut, one end of the threaded column sequentially penetrates through the first nut, the lamp panel and the second nut, and the other end, opposite to one end of the threaded column, is fixedly connected with the inner wall of the shell.
From the above description, it can be known that the lamp panel can keep a certain distance from the top of the inner cavity of the housing when being installed through the mutual matching of the threaded column, the first nut and the second nut, so that the heat of the lamp panel can be rapidly dissipated.
Furthermore, the threaded column is made of copper.
As can be known from the above description, the threaded column is made of copper, so that the copper column has a good heat conduction effect and can facilitate heat transfer.
Furthermore, the outer surface of the shell is also provided with more than two radiating fins.
As is apparent from the above description, the heat dissipation effect of the case can be further improved by providing two or more heat dissipation fins on the outer surface of the case.
Referring to fig. 1 and fig. 2, a first embodiment of the present invention is:
referring to fig. 1, a high heat dissipation LED street lamp cover includes an upper lamp cover 1, a housing 2 and a lower lamp cover 3, the upper lampshade 1 is fixedly arranged on the outer surface of the shell 2, the lower lampshade 3 is covered at the opening of the shell 2 and closes the opening, a lamp panel 6 and an LED lamp 5 are arranged in the inner cavity of the shell 2, the LED lamp 5 is arranged on one side surface of the lamp panel 6 close to the lower lampshade 3, a radiating fin plate 4 is embedded on one side surface of the shell 2 close to the upper lampshade 1, an air exchange component 7 is arranged on the outer surface of the upper lampshade 1, an air inlet pipe 8 and an air outlet pipe 9 are respectively communicated with two opposite sides of the air exchange component 7, one end of the air inlet pipe 8 extends to the inner cavity of the upper lampshade 1, an air inlet at one end of the air inlet pipe 8 faces the radiating fin plate 4, one end of the air outlet pipe 9 extends to the inner cavity of the upper lampshade 1, and the air outlet at one end of the air outlet pipe 9 faces the radiating fin plate 4.
The heat dissipation fin plate 4 is embedded in the center of one side face, close to the upper lampshade 1, of the shell 2.
The lower lampshade 3 is in threaded connection with the shell 2.
Referring to fig. 2, the ventilation assembly 7 includes a ventilation housing 71, a refrigerator 72, a connection pipe 73 and an air extractor 74 are disposed in an inner cavity of the ventilation housing 71, the refrigerator 72 is communicated with the air extractor 74 through the connection pipe 73, the air inlet pipe 8 is communicated with the air extractor 74, and the air outlet pipe 9 is communicated with the refrigerator 72.
Referring to fig. 1, a threaded column is further disposed in an inner cavity of the housing 2, a first nut 11 and a second nut 12 are respectively disposed on two opposite side surfaces of the lamp panel 6, one end of the threaded column is fixedly connected to an inner wall of the housing 2, and the other end of the threaded column opposite to the one end thereof sequentially penetrates through the first nut 11 and the lamp panel 6 to be connected to the second nut 12.
The number of the threaded columns is two, the threaded columns are symmetrically arranged on the lamp panel 6 respectively, one threaded column is correspondingly matched with a first nut 11 and a second nut 12, and the two threaded columns are made of copper.
Two radiating fins 13 are further arranged on the outer surface of the shell 2.
The heat dissipation principle of the LED street lamp shade with high heat dissipation is as follows:
during the installation, adjust the position of first nut 11 earlier, then pass bolt post 10 and butt first nut 11 with the both ends of lamp panel 6, then lock second nut 12, make second nut 12 and 6 butts of lamp panel, thereby accomplish the installation of lamp panel 6, and make lamp panel 6 and 2 inner chamber tops of casing keep certain distance, it is better to make the radiating effect, then install LED lamp 5 on lamp panel 6, lamp shade 3 will be installed in 2 bottoms of casing down at last, thereby accomplish the installation of LED lamp 5.
When the LED lamp 5 works to generate heat, the generated main heat is transferred through the heat dissipation fins 4, the heat is transferred into the upper lampshade 1, then the air extractor 74 and the refrigerator 72 are started, the air extractor 74 pumps the hot air inside the upper lampshade 1 into the refrigerator 72 through the air inlet pipe 8, the hot air is absorbed and converted into cold air through the refrigerator 72, and then the cold air is discharged into the upper lampshade 1 through the air outlet pipe 9, so that the temperature inside the upper lampshade 1 is reduced, the heat transfer of the heat dissipation fins 4 can be normally performed, and part of the heat is dissipated through the heat dissipation fins 13 on the side wall of the shell 2.
